Seung Hyuk Nahm (남승혁) won with an average of 5.30 seconds in the 3x3x3 Cube event. Kantaro Sakamoto (坂本貫太郎) finished second (7.26) and Takeru Iguchi (井口丈瑠) finished third (7.51).
